Kingdom: Animalia
Tribe: Arthropoda
Class: Arachnida
Order: Araneae
Family: Gnaphosidae
Genus: Scotophaeus
Species: S. pretiosus
Binomial name: Scotophaeus pretiosus

Scotophaeus pretiosus is a small endemic stealthy ground hunting spider. This very fast spider has a body length of about 8mm, it hunts at night and hides during the day under rocks and leaves. The body of the spider is oval-shaped with a distinctive pattern.
